Lemon Sunblaze Rose - Tree Form

All the Sunblaze® roses bring us gorgeous miniature blooms on small shrubs, and when attached to a strong trunk they make the most charming tree roses. The Sunblaze® Lemon Rose Tree is especially charming, with perfect small roses packed with petals, and in the most gorgeous yellow tones, deeper in the center of the bloom, surrounded by soft creamy tones in the outer petals. Each one a miniature work of art, the flowers are no more than 2½ inches across, but they have the charm of a full-sized rose, and what an abundance they are produced in! Clusters of buds make every branch a bouquet, and blooming comes in waves from early summer right into the fall. Glossy, deep green foliage makes the perfect background to these soft colors, and all in all makes this rose a true beauty in your garden, and especially useful for a pot on a terrace, patio or balcony. - Soft citrus coloring of yellow, turning to cream in the outer petals - Small blooms of many petals have incredible charm and beauty - Abundant blooming means flowers from early summer right into fall - Attractive glossy, dark-green foliage - Ideal for smaller gardens and growing in pots Choose a spot in full sun for your Sunblaze® Lemon Tree Rose, which will maximize blooming. Plant in rich soil - add plenty of compost or organic materials when preparing the spot. Enjoys heavy soils, including clay, if loosened with organic material. For pots, mix 1 part garden soil with 3 parts potting soil. Water regularly, and dont let the soil dry during summer or blooming will be reduced. Prune in spring, leaving a compact framework of larger branches.
